Transaction 517d17c53fae9577299695fb14b77245c34acc2d97ee1eea68af14fd63e7b295
1 Input
2 Outputs
- 517d17c53fae9577299695fb14b77245c34acc2d97ee1eea68af14fd63e7b295:0
- 517d17c53fae9577299695fb14b77245c34acc2d97ee1eea68af14fd63e7b295:1
value 34922056
address 124wiRjyqPqVRJmL7BxhgoNP3RGJuyrhZW
value 454949329
address 1JNsvwfGcjQaTx2HHz1B6adeXwQG9URyYz